It *USED* to be that if any knockout game was tied after ninety minutes, they replayed it 3-7 days later. Sometimes it got ridiculous, for example, in 1971, Alvechurch and Oxford City had to play each other SIX times to get a winner ( 22 November 1971: The longest-ever FA Cup tie finally finishes | Sport | The Guardian )

There's never been a rule for "unlimited OT", it's always been Extra Time, then replay or PKs
